Crime overview

Jeremys Green area has the 34th lowest crime rate of 73 local areas in Edmonton Green , and the 235th highest crime rate of 836 local areas in Enfield .

At least one of the neighbouring streets has high or very high crime levels. However, overall crime around this postcode is more mixed, with some nearby areas experiencing lower crime.

The overall crime rate in the area around Jeremys Green (N18 2NB) in the last 12 months was 125.8 per 1,000 residents and was 40.0% lower than the Edmonton Green average (209.8 per 1,000 residents). In the last 12 months, this area’s most reported crimes were Violence and sexual offences with 19 offences recorded. The least common crime was Bicycle theft with 1 case , up 100.0% compared to 2024. The fastest-growing crime category was Drugs ( 150.0% YoY). The sharpest decline was Vehicle crime ( -80.0% YoY).

Violent crimes totalled 20 (β‰ˆ 61.4 per 1,000 residents). Year-over-year these were falling ( -25.9% ). Over the last decade, overall crime has falling ( -24.1% comparing early vs recent averages) .

In the area around Jeremys Green (N18 2NB), the highest concentration of overall crime is near Grilse Close, where police recorded 59 incidents. Violent and public-order offences occur most often near Swaythling Close (26 offences). Both locations lie within roughly 0.3 miles of this postcode area.
